Chapter 1: The Hangul Alphabet

The Korean alphabet, known as Hangul, is a unique and phonetic system that consists of 24 letters (14 consonants and 10 vowels). This chapter will introduce you to the shapes, pronunciations, and formation of each Hangul character.

Chapter 2: Syllable Formation

Korean syllables are composed of a consonant, a vowel, and optionally a final consonant. This chapter will teach you the rules for forming syllables, including the principles of syllable structure and consonant assimilation.
